## Deploying the Gatewick Proctor Queue

Deploys are pretty painless: push to main, wait for the pipeline, then watch the queue drain dashboard for five minutes. If candidates pile up mid-exam, roll back first and ask questions later — the queue replays safely. Everything the workers care about lives in one config block, shown here for reference.

settings of bafof-yagef:
JOROX_PIN=8740
JOROX_TENANT=pelox
JOROX_METRICS_HOST=metrics.jorox.qorvelworks.internal
JOROX_SEAL=seal_c78f63c1
JOROX_STANDBY_TEAM=norax

## Changelog — Font vendoring defaults changed

As of this release, the Bracken UI build no longer fetches third-party fonts at build time. All typefaces used by the Lanternwell suite are now vendored into the repo under a dedicated assets directory, and the fetch step is skipped by default. If you're onboarding, nothing to install — the fonts travel with the checkout. The build flags controlling this behavior are listed below.

settings of hadup-yafog:
LAMAEL_PIN=3761
LAMAEL_TENANT=istmir
LAMAEL_METRICS_HOST=metrics.lamael.plorvasys.test
LAMAEL_SEAL=seal_8ea68500
LAMAEL_STANDBY_TEAM=fraok

Runbook: canary gating for the Quillbrook checkout service. Promotions proceed only if the canary slice holds for two consecutive evaluation windows with error rate, p99 latency, and saturation all inside thresholds. A single breach pauses rollout; two breaches trigger automatic rollback and page the on-call. Reviewers should confirm that gating thresholds match what is committed in the deploy manifest, since the evaluator reads them at promotion time, not at build time. The effective gating configuration is reproduced below for verification.

config for kawif-hahig:
zorix:
  log_level: error
  metrics_host: metrics.zorix.lumiclabs.internal
  pool_size: 16